Chris Pine's friends want him to settle down.

The 'Star Trek' star, who was arrested for driving under the influence in New Zealand last March, has reportedly been partying a lot in recent weeks and his team are allegedly worried about him.

A source said: ''Chris is in high demand as a leading man, but there are real worries that his behaviour could tarnish his reputation.''

The heartthrob received a $79 fine and six-month ban on his licence for the incident, but the source said: ''He acts like he got away with it.''

The 34-year-old actor was recently spotted kissing 'Vanderpump Rules' star Vail Bloom, 32, in Los Angeles, but his pals hope he finds a serious relationship.

The insider added: ''His team is worried that Chris' partying will undo everything he's worked so hard for.

''His team is just hoping that he'll finally meet a girl so he can settle down and stay out of trouble.''

Chris, who was linked to 'The Newsroom' star Olivia Munn and former 'The Hills' star Audrina Patridge in the past, previously admitted he found it difficult to have a steady relationship in Hollywood.

Speaking about his split from model Dominique Piek in 2013, he told US OK! magazine: ''It's really hard in our business to maintain something. For me, right now, it'd be really hard.''
